(2013-12-19, 18:00)Reddog999 Wrote: I'm not sure if this is a fair or even useful comparison and I will probably get shot down by some of the more knowledgeable people on this forum but I tried copying my thumbnails folder to another location on the storage usb using:
"time cp -r /storage/.xbmc/userdata/Thumbnails/* /storage/downloads/Thumbnails"

Seems a valid test to me. I'm surprised the difference was so great, but this is certainly interesting information. Thanks.

What might be interesting is installing a new add-on or skin. I think the write speed would be significant in that.
I seem to remember Aeon Nox took a couple of minutes to install. Installing from a zip file would avoid internet download speed being the bottleneck.

Another test would be something like:
Code:
./texturecache.py C movies
Again that might be dominated by internet download speed or jpeg decode/encode, but it might show a difference.
